Transaction f5ddac7893db8f0f44afc8208c829eecfde3dbf13e2383a6c9a7519eba34a642
3 Input
2 Outputs
- f5ddac7893db8f0f44afc8208c829eecfde3dbf13e2383a6c9a7519eba34a642:0
- f5ddac7893db8f0f44afc8208c829eecfde3dbf13e2383a6c9a7519eba34a642:1
value 100003
address 17Qy1v7wBo9M6yLca5P7ucYdrcSb6fZ38b
value 859319
address 1914UG6qVkZx1gSNr5DmGN6VxGQJrwbBB2